A bicycle rear-wheel sprocket pairing for engaging in a meshing, force-transmitting and form-fitting manner with a bicycle roller chain, wherein the rear-wheel sprocket pairing is rotatable about a sprocket axis. The sprocket axis defines an axial direction running along the sprocket axis, a radial direction running so as to be orthogonal to the sprocket axis, and a circumferential direction encircling the sprocket axis. The rear-wheel sprocket pairing comprises a larger sprocket and a smaller sprocket which for rotating conjointly with the larger sprocket in a slip-free manner about the sprocket axis is connected to the larger sprocket so as to be coaxial with and axially directly adjacent to the latter. The larger sprocket has an even tooth count of equal to or less than twenty-two teeth, and the difference in the tooth count between the larger and the smaller sprocket is exactly two teeth.
